Understanding Jawbone Loss and Deterioration: Causes and Solutions

Reasons for Jawbone Loss and Deterioration

Jawbone loss is a serious oral health concern that can affect the structure of your face, the stability of your teeth, and your ability to receive dental implants. The jawbone requires constant stimulation to maintain its density and strength. When that stimulation is lost—whether due to missing teeth, trauma, or disease—the bone begins to weaken and shrink. Fortunately, bone grafting procedures can restore lost bone, allowing patients to regain oral function and preserve their facial structure.

How Tooth Loss Contributes to Bone Deterioration

One of the leading causes of jawbone loss is missing teeth. Natural teeth are embedded in the jawbone and provide the stimulation needed to keep the bone healthy. When a tooth is removed and not replaced, the alveolar bone—the part of the jaw that holds teeth in place—begins to resorb, or break down. The majority of bone loss occurs within the first 18 months of losing a tooth, but the deterioration continues over time. This can lead to further dental issues, such as difficulty chewing, shifting teeth, and changes in facial appearance. Bone grafting can rebuild the lost bone, ensuring a strong foundation for future dental implants.

The Link Between Periodontal Disease and Jawbone Damage

Gum disease is another major factor in jawbone deterioration. Periodontitis, an advanced form of gum disease, affects the tissues and bones that support teeth. As the condition progresses, it destroys the alveolar bone, leading to tooth loss and further bone damage.

Plaque buildup is the primary cause of gum disease, and without proper oral hygiene, bacteria produce toxins that inflame and damage the gums. As the gum tissue recedes, pockets form between the teeth and gums, allowing bacteria to spread deeper. If left untreated, this leads to the loss of bone structure. Scaling and root planing, periodontal maintenance, and bone grafting can help restore oral health and prevent further bone loss.

How Dentures and Bridgework Affect Jawbone Health

Traditional dentures and some bridgework can contribute to jawbone deterioration over time. Unanchored dentures sit on top of the gums and do not stimulate the underlying bone, leading to gradual bone resorption. As the bone shrinks, dentures can become loose and uncomfortable, making it difficult to eat and speak properly.
Bridgework, while offering some stability, only stimulates the bone where natural teeth remain. The portion of the bridge that spans the missing tooth does not engage the bone, leading to resorption in that area. Dental implants provide a long-term solution by integrating with the jawbone, preventing bone loss, and offering superior stability compared to traditional dentures and bridges.

How Trauma and Injuries Lead to Bone Loss

Jawbone loss is not always a gradual process—sometimes, it occurs due to trauma. Accidents, sports injuries, or falls can knock out teeth or fracture the jawbone. When a tooth is lost or severely damaged, the surrounding bone loses stimulation, causing it to shrink over time.

In some cases, a tooth that was injured years earlier may die, leading to hidden bone deterioration. Bone grafting procedures can restore the affected area, rebuilding lost bone and making it possible to receive dental implants or other restorative treatments.

The Role of Misalignment in Jawbone Deterioration

When teeth are not properly aligned, certain areas of the jaw may receive excessive force while others receive none at all. Unopposed teeth—those that do not have a counterpart to bite against—can over-erupt, leading to increased stress on the jawbone and causing deterioration.
Other factors, such as TMJ disorders, excessive teeth grinding, and untreated orthodontic issues, can contribute to abnormal wear and tear on the jawbone. Orthodontic treatments, night guards, and targeted interventions can help balance bite forces and prevent further damage.

How Osteomyelitis Leads to Jawbone Loss

Osteomyelitis is a serious bacterial infection that affects the bone and bone marrow. This condition can cause inflammation, leading to reduced blood supply and bone destruction. Treatment typically involves antibiotics and, in severe cases, surgical removal of the infected bone.
Following the removal of infected bone, a bone grafting procedure may be necessary to restore lost structure and function. This ensures that patients can regain strength in their jaw and prevent further complications.

The Impact of Tumors on Jawbone Structure

Benign and malignant tumors can affect the jawbone, sometimes requiring the removal of a section of the bone. Benign tumors, while non-cancerous, may grow large enough to weaken or displace bone. Malignant tumors, on the other hand, can spread into the jaw, making bone removal necessary for effective treatment.
In both cases, reconstructive bone grafting can help restore function and stability after tumor removal. For cancer patients, additional considerations may be needed if surrounding soft tissues have also been affected by the treatment process.

Developmental Deformities and Jawbone Deficiencies

Certain congenital conditions can cause parts of the jawbone to be underdeveloped or missing altogether. Birth defects or syndromes that affect facial bone growth can result in asymmetrical jaw structure and difficulty with chewing or speaking.

In such cases, bone grafting procedures can help restore missing bone and improve jaw function. Custom treatment plans are developed based on the patient’s specific needs, ensuring that both function and aesthetics are addressed.

How Sinus Issues Contribute to Jawbone Loss

When upper molars are removed, the maxillary sinus—the air-filled cavity in the upper jaw—may expand due to lack of bone support. This process, called sinus pneumatization, can lead to insufficient bone height for dental implants. A sinus lift procedure can correct this issue by adding bone to the area, ensuring a stable foundation for implants. This treatment is particularly important for patients who want to replace missing upper teeth with dental implants.
